WebNo premises may have more than 12 temporary events notices per year. Most individuals can have a maximum of 5 notices per year. An individual with a Personal Licence (ie a Landlord) can have a maximum of 50 Temporary Events Licences a year. A minimum of 24 hours between events. A maximum aggregate duration of 15 days per year. WebDec 6, 2024 · Late TENs. It is possible to apply for “late” Temporary Event Notices by giving between five and nine working days notice, although there is a limit of 10 Late Temporary Event Notices each calendar year for an individual holding a Personal Licence (out of their total of 50), and two (out of their total of 5) for those who do not. christian anointing oil https://cathleennaughtonassoc.com

WebThis does not include the day you submit the notice to us or the day of the event itself. Bank holidays do not count as a work. As the organiser of the event you must apply for the temporary event notice and pay the £21 fee online. The licensing authority will serve the notice on the responsible authorities, on behalf of the applicant. WebPaper Temporary Event Notice. If you submit a paper notice you must send two copies of your notice to the Licensing Authority and one copy of your notice to the Police. The notice must be received by no later than ten working days before the event period, not including the day served or the day of the event. Contact details of the authorities ...
